Previously we had an index on the value field, which was very expensive for
long fields. Instead we use a separate column and take the first 8 characters
of the field value's md5sum, and index that. In decks with lots of text in
fields, it can cut the deck size by 30% or more, and many decks improve by
10-20%. Decks with only a few characters in fields may increase in size
slightly, but this is offset by the fact that we only generate a checksum for
fields that have uniqueness checking on.
Also, fixed import->update reporting the total # of available facts instead of
the number of facts that were imported.
- media is no longer hashed, and instead stored in the db using its original
name
- when adding media, its checksum is calculated and used to look for
duplicates
- duplicate filenames will result in a number tacked on the file
- the size column is used to count card references to media. If media is
referenced in a fact but not the question or answer, the count will be zero.
- there is no guarantee media will be listed in the media db if it is unused
on the question & answer
- if rebuildMediaDir(delete=True), then entries with zero references are
deleted, along with any unused files in the media dir.
- rebuildMediaDir() will update the internal checksums, and set the checksum
to "" if a file can't be found
- rebuildMediaDir() is a lot less destructive now, and will leave alone
directories it finds in the media folder (but not look in them either)
- rebuildMediaDir() returns more information about the state of media now
- the online and mobile clients will need to to make sure that when
downloading media, entries with no checksum are non-fatal and should not
abort the download process.
- the ref count is updated every time the q/a is updated - so the db should be
up to date after every add/edit/import
- since we look for media on the q/a now, card templates like '<img
src="{{{field}}}">' will work now
- export original files as gone as it is not needed anymore
- move from per-model media URL to deckVar. downloadMissingMedia() uses this
now. Deck subscriptions will have to be updated to share media another way.

newSpacing is a time in seconds to delay introduction of sibling new cards.
It can be applied as many times as necessary as there is no harm in new cards
being delayed repeatedly. Because the default queue length is 200 and it can
take quite some time for the spaced cards to be placed in the queue again, we
use a separate array to track spaced new cards provided the configured delay
is less than 20 minutes. At times under 20 minutes this number is not a
guaranteed minimum spacing - if the new card queue is empty the spaced cards
will be flushed before checking the new queue again, as otherwise we end up
trying to fill on every repetition. The due counts no longer decrease by more
than one if the spacing is less than the due cutoff, since that confused some
users.
Review cards are now placed at the end of the current review queue, and will
never be rescheduled to a different day. The old approach had a number of
problems:
- the more card models you had, the more likely a card would be spaced
multiple times, resulting in you forgetting the card before you get a chance
to review it
- spacing was applied even if the due card was already late
- repeatedly failing one card over a period of days or weeks would also stave
the other cards of attention
